Brief Summary
IperionX reported a loss of $0.7513 per share with no revenue for the first three quarters of the 2024 fiscal year, highlighting ongoing financial struggles and lack of income generation.

Business Status and Future Prospects
- Financial Challenges: The lack of revenue and increased EPS loss highlight significant financial challenges, suggesting potential liquidity issues and the need for strategic diversification or cost management.
- Future Development Trends: While IperionX received a $47.1 million funding contract from the U.S. Department of Defense for developing a titanium supply chain, which could provide future revenue streamsBaystreet, the current financial figures suggest immediate challenges and no apparent breakthroughs in revenue generation. This contract might offer a strategic catalyst for future growth but hasn’t yet influenced the fiscal outcomes reported.
